you will find yearly constraints, which can be set to be a share of one's modified gross income (AGI), on the amount you can deduct for charitable contributions. The limits vary according to the nature in the donation (e.g., income vs. serious residence) plus the position on the Business. The allowance for donations to community charities, which typically are organizations with wide general public assistance—which include Habitat for Humanity or school or university—is greater than that for A non-public non-functioning Basis (a company with only one or a handful of donors and directors, mostly a grant-building foundation).
